Aston Martin repaired Lance Stroll's AMR24 ahead of the Brazilian GP, and then he drove 'straight into' the gravel trap.

Lance Stroll has been slated for his formation lap antics in Brazil, not because he spun off but because he “drove straight into that f***ing gravel trap”.had a Sunday to forget at the Interlagos circuit as he crashed in the morning’s qualifying session and, despite his mechanics working furiously to repair his car, didn’t take the start grid after beaching his car on the formation lap.Leaving the grid for the formation lap, Stroll appeared to lock his rear wheel and spun off the track.

“He thinks to cut the track via the gravel trap, and then he is stuck! How do you face your team then! “His team-mate, Fernando Alonso, didn’t have a great race either, but he did say on the radio that he was dying from the pain of bouncing but that he finished the race for the mechanics,” Doornbos said.

Aston Martin left Brazil without a single point on the board, their third successive non-score. They, however, remain P5 in thewhere they are 37 points ahead of Brazil’s big winners Alpine, who managed a double podium in the wet.F1 penalty points: Max Verstappen more than halfway to race ban after Brazil VSC incident
